Does Will Die in Stranger Things

Will Byers' Survival Status in Stranger Things

Will Byers does not die in Stranger Things. The character remains alive through the series' latest season, with his storyline focusing on supernatural threats and personal growth rather than death. Netflix's official Stranger Things series page confirms Will is a core protagonist across all seasons. The character's survival is a key narrative choice that supports the show's ensemble structure and ongoing plot arcs.

Character Arc and Narrative Role

Will's arc centers on his connection to the Upside Down and his role as a sensitive conduit for supernatural events. The show treats his experiences as a critical plot mechanism rather than a fatal storyline. Writers use his vulnerability to advance group dynamics and the central conflict between the main characters and interdimensional threats.

Key Plot Points Involving Will Byers

Major story beats include Will's initial disappearance, his return with lingering ties to the Upside Down, and his ongoing struggles with visions and possession attempts. These events drive group cohesion and the development of protective relationships among the core friend group. The narrative consistently resolves these threats without killing the character, preserving his role as a unifying emotional anchor for the ensemble.
